a quick look in Malwarebytes log show that most of this is PUP detections...
PUP = not a virus / [b]P[/b]ossible [b]U[/b]nwanted [b]P[/b]rogram
avast PUP scan is default off ..... and only default on in bootscan
unless you know what you do i recomend you keep it that way and let Malwarebytes handle the PUPs as what it targets are just crap
avast however also class some factory installed programs as PUP bc of what they can do…
so if you are going to use avast PUP scan in the future, be sure you know what is detected before you take any action
